在Debian系統中進行Java網絡配置時,需要注意以下幾個要點:
網絡接口配置文件:
/etc/network/interfaces。在此文件中,可以設置靜態IP地址或通過DHCP動態獲取IP地址。auto lo
iface lo inet loopback
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
dns-nameservers 8.8.8.8 8.8.4.4
auto eth0
iface eth0 inet dhcp
使用NetworkManager:
nmcli命令來管理網絡連接。sudo nmcli con show
sudo nmcli con mod "ens33" ipv4.addresses 192.168.125.137/24
sudo nmcli con up "ens33"
Netplan(適用于Debian 10及以后版本):
/etc/netplan/*.yaml。network:
version: 2
renderer: networkd
ethernets:
ens33:
dhcp4: no
addresses: [192.168.125.134/24]
gateway4: 192.168.125.2
nameservers:
addresses: [8.8.8.8, 8.8.4.4]
sudo netplan apply
配置DNS服務器:
/etc/resolv.conf文件來設置DNS服務器,但此文件在系統重啟后可能會丟失設置。建議使用resolvconf來永久保存DNS配置。echo "nameserver 8.8.8.8" | sudo tee /etc/resolv.conf
網絡服務重啟:
sudo systemctl restart networking
驗證網絡配置:
ping命令來驗證網絡連接是否正常。例如:ping www.google.com
通過以上步驟和配置要點,可以確保Debian系統在網絡連接方面的穩定性和可靠性。